...Nicolas V. Jaumard; William C. Welch; Beth A. Winkelstein The facet joint is a crucial anatomic region of the spine owing to its biomechanical role in facilitating articulation of the vertebrae of the spinal column. It is a diarthrodial joint with opposing articular cartilage surfaces that provide...
